Career Role Description
Autonomous Vehicle Fleet Control Engineer Develops and maintains control systems for autonomous fleets, focusing on optimization and safety. High demand for expertise in real-time systems and AI.
AI/ML Specialist (Autonomous Driving) Develops and deploys machine learning algorithms for perception, decision-making, and path planning in autonomous vehicles. Critical role in advancing fleet autonomy.
Robotics Engineer (Autonomous Systems) Designs and implements robotic systems for autonomous vehicle operation, including sensor integration and control mechanisms. Essential for fleet scalability and performance.
Data Scientist (Autonomous Vehicle) Analyzes large datasets generated by autonomous fleets to identify trends, improve performance, and ensure safety. Crucial for data-driven decision making in fleet management.
Software Engineer (Autonomous Fleet Control) Develops and maintains software for autonomous fleet control systems, contributing to system reliability and efficiency. Strong programming skills are essential.
